Yes — for wholesale sales teams with negotiation-heavy deals and customer-specific price lists, I’d recommend looking at DealHub or Salesforce CPQ, depending on how complex your process is.

Best fit if you want flexibility and strong sales workflows: DealHub

DealHub is a solid choice for teams that need:

  • Negotiation workflows with approvals
  • Customer-specific pricing
  • Discount controls
  • Quote and deal collaboration
  • Faster deployment than many enterprise CPQ tools

It tends to be a good fit when sales reps need to adjust pricing often, but you still want governance around margin and approvals.

Best fit if you already live in Salesforce and need deep configurability: Salesforce CPQ

Salesforce CPQ is often the best option when you need:

  • Complex pricing rules
  • Detailed customer price lists and contract pricing
  • Tight CRM integration
  • Approval processes for exceptions
  • Scalability for larger, more mature sales ops teams

It’s powerful, but implementation can be heavier and may require more admin/support resources.

Other good options to consider

  • Conga CPQ — good for quoting plus document automation
  • PROS Smart CPQ — strong for price optimization and dynamic pricing
  • SAP CPQ — worth considering if you’re in the SAP ecosystem

Quick recommendation

  • If you want speed, usability, and negotiation support: DealHub
  • If you want deep Salesforce-native CPQ capability: Salesforce CPQ
  • If pricing is highly strategic and optimization-driven: PROS Smart CPQ
